Understanding the Purpose of a Parents Consent Letter
A Parents Consent Letter Sample for School serves as a formal declaration from a parent or legal guardian granting permission for their child to participate in a specific activity or for a particular purpose. This document is vital for protecting both the school and the child. It ensures that the school has explicit permission for actions that might otherwise require parental approval, such as attending field trips, receiving medical treatment in an emergency, or sharing student work.
The importance of having a written record of consent cannot be overstated. It provides legal protection for the school in case of unforeseen circumstances and clearly outlines the responsibilities and permissions granted. For parents, it offers peace of mind knowing exactly what their child is authorized to do. Here are some common elements found in a Parents Consent Letter Sample for School:
- Child's Full Name
- Student ID Number (if applicable)
- Date of Birth
- Specific Activity/Purpose for Consent
- Dates and Times of Activity
- Emergency Contact Information
- Parent/Guardian Signature and Date
Here's a basic structure you might find in a comprehensive Parents Consent Letter Sample for School:
- Heading: Clearly states it's a consent letter.
- Introduction: Identifies the child and the purpose of the letter.
- Details of the Activity: Provides all necessary information about what the consent is for.
- Permissions Granted: Clearly states what the school is permitted to do.
- Emergency Clause: Outlines actions in case of medical emergencies.
- Contact Information: Provides ways to reach the parent/guardian.
- Acknowledgement and Signature: Parent/guardian confirms understanding and grants consent.
Parents Consent Letter Sample for School for a Field Trip
Dear [Teacher's Name] and [School Name] Administration,
I am writing to give my full consent for my child, [Child's Full Name], born on [Child's Date of Birth], with Student ID [Student ID Number], to participate in the upcoming field trip to [Destination of Field Trip] on [Date of Field Trip].
I understand that the trip is scheduled to depart at [Departure Time] and return by [Return Time]. I have made arrangements for my child to be picked up promptly at [Pick-up Location] upon their return.
In the event of a medical emergency, I authorize the school staff to seek appropriate medical attention for my child, including transportation to the nearest medical facility if necessary. My emergency contact number is [Emergency Phone Number], and my secondary contact is [Secondary Emergency Phone Number].
Thank you for providing this educational opportunity for my child.
Sincerely,
[Parent/Guardian Full Name]
[Date]
Parents Consent Letter Sample for School for Emergency Medical Treatment
To Whom It May Concern at [School Name],
This letter serves as a standing consent for emergency medical treatment for my child, [Child's Full Name], born on [Child's Date of Birth], with Student ID [Student ID Number].
In the event that my child requires immediate medical attention and I or my designated emergency contact cannot be reached promptly, I hereby grant permission for the school personnel or designated medical professionals to provide necessary medical care, including but not limited to, first aid, administration of necessary medication, and transportation to a medical facility.
I understand that this consent is for emergency situations only and that the school will make every effort to contact me as soon as possible.
My primary emergency contact information is: [Emergency Phone Number], and my secondary contact is: [Secondary Emergency Phone Number].
Thank you for your diligence in ensuring the safety and well-being of our students.
Sincerely,
[Parent/Guardian Full Name]
[Date]
Parents Consent Letter Sample for School for Photo and Video Release
Dear [School Name] Administration,
I, [Parent/Guardian Full Name], parent/guardian of [Child's Full Name] (DOB: [Child's Date of Birth], Student ID: [Student ID Number]), hereby grant permission for [School Name] to use photographs and/or video recordings of my child for school-related purposes.
These purposes may include, but are not limited to, school publications (yearbook, newsletters, website), promotional materials, and classroom projects. I understand that the images will be used solely for the educational and promotional benefit of the school and that my child's name may or may not be used in conjunction with the photographs or videos.
I waive any right to inspect or approve the finished product wherein my child's likeness appears. I also understand that I will not receive any compensation for the use of these photographs or videos.
Please note that I do NOT wish for my child's image to be used in any external publications or media outlets without my further written consent.
Sincerely,
[Parent/Guardian Full Name]
[Date]
Parents Consent Letter Sample for School for Medication Administration
To the School Nurse and Staff of [School Name],
I am writing to provide consent for the administration of medication to my child, [Child's Full Name], born on [Child's Date of Birth], with Student ID [Student ID Number].
The medication required is [Medication Name], dosage of [Dosage], to be administered [Frequency of Administration] at school. The prescription is from Dr. [Doctor's Name].
I have attached a copy of the prescription and instructions from the doctor. Please ensure that the medication is stored and administered according to these guidelines.
If you have any questions or concerns regarding the administration of this medication, please do not hesitate to contact me at [Parent/Guardian Phone Number].
Thank you for your care and attention to my child's health needs.
Sincerely,
[Parent/Guardian Full Name]
[Date]
